Conservation professionals Salary Guide UK — 2025
Complete breakdown based on ONS ASHE official data
The median conservation professionals salary in the UK is £37,949 per year, based on the 2025 Annual Survey of Hours and Earnings (ASHE) published by the Office for National Statistics. The mean salary is £42,224, reflecting the influence of higher earners on the average. The median hourly rate is £19.77.
Salaries vary significantly by region, from £32,896 in Scotland to £41,860 in East. However, these differences narrow when adjusted for regional cost of living.

Regional Salary Breakdown
The "Adjusted" column shows purchasing power after accounting for regional cost of living (UK average = 100).
| Region | Median | Mean | CoL Adjusted |
|---|---|---|---|
| East | £41,860 | £40,129 | £43,022 |
| North West | £35,533 | £36,175 | £38,962 |
| South East | £34,801 | £40,012 | £33,722 |
| Wales | £33,507 | £36,476 | £37,230 |
| Scotland | £32,896 | £35,022 | £35,640 |
